Olympus PEN-F vs Samsung ST150F Physical Comparison

If you're aiming to travel with your camera often, you will need to take into account its weight and dimensions. The Olympus PEN-F has got outside dimensions of 125mm x 72mm x 37mm (4.9" x 2.8" x 1.5") having a weight of 427 grams (0.94 lbs) and the Samsung ST150F has dimensions of 94mm x 58mm x 18mm (3.7" x 2.3" x 0.7") along with a weight of 114 grams (0.25 lbs).

Olympus PEN-F vs Samsung ST150F Sensor Comparison

Sometimes, it is tough to imagine the difference in sensor dimensions just by seeing specs. The picture below may provide you a much better sense of the sensor dimensions in the PEN-F and ST150F.

All in all, each of the cameras have got different megapixels and different sensor dimensions. The PEN-F with its bigger sensor is going to make getting shallow DOF easier and the Olympus PEN-F will produce extra detail with its extra 4MP. Higher resolution will let you crop pictures much more aggressively. The newer PEN-F should have a benefit with regard to sensor tech.
